Understanding the Importance of Facial Cleansing
Everyone should be regularly washing their face. But make sure you aren't overdoing it. Proper face cleansing is essential for maintaining healthy skin, and the right techniques and products can enhance your skincare routine significantly. Board-certified dermatologist Dr. Mansha Thacker emphasizes that a gentle approach is often the best strategy.
The consensus among skincare experts, including Dr. Thacker, is that washing your face twice a day is optimal for most individuals. This routine typically entails a quick cleanse in the morning to remove any overnight impurities and a thorough wash in the evening to clear off sweat, dirt, and any products applied during the day. As Dr. Thacker explains, "If you're just using a gentle, hydrating cleanser, using that twice a day is fine." However, for those with dryer skin, it may be beneficial to wash the face with just warm water in the morning and reserve the cleanser for the evening.
Choosing the Right Cleanser
The type of product you use makes a significant difference in your facial cleansing routine. Opt for products that are specifically labeled as face cleansers and steer clear of bar soaps. Regular bar soap can cause dry skin and might contain sulfates or foaming agents that exacerbate the issue. Consider these pros when choosing the right facial cleanser
- Hydrating Ingredients: Look for cleansers containing ingredients like glycerin or hyaluronic acid to retain moisture.
- pH Balanced: Products with a balanced pH help maintain your skin’s natural barrier, avoiding irritation or dryness.
- Non-Surfactant Based: Avoid products with heavy foaming agents that can strip the skin of its beneficial oils.
Double Cleansing for Heavy Makeup Days
Incorporating a preliminary cleanser is crucial on days you wear heavy makeup or sunscreen. Dr. Thacker advocates starting your evening skincare routine with an oil-based product or makeup balm. This step effectively dissolves heavy makeup and sunscreen residue before you follow up with a gentle face wash. Avoiding Over-Washing Your Face
Striking a balance is key. While maintaining a routine, the risk of over-washing is prevalent and it can lead to unwanted side effects like irritation and breakouts. Dr. Thacker outlines two significant ways people tend to over-wash their skin
1. Using Harsh Scrubs: Many mistakenly believe that aggressive scrubbing leads to better results. However, using overly abrasive scrubs can cause micro-abrasions on the skin and worsen irritations. 2. Active Ingredients: Face washes that contain active ingredients like glycolic or salicylic acids should not be used excessively. Limit these products to once a day or every other day, as using them too frequently might irritate the skin instead of helping it.
